Introduction
The Honeywell 900B01-0301 Analog Output Module is a high-quality and reliable solution for industrial control applications. It is part of Honeywell’s renowned series of automation and control modules, designed for precision and efficiency. The 900B01-0301 module serves as an essential component for converting digital signals from a controller into analog signals that can control external equipment or process variables, such as valves, actuators, and other process control devices. With its advanced features and robust construction, this module is ideal for use in diverse industries such as manufacturing, energy, and process control systems.
Product Specifications
Feature | Specification |
Model | 900B01-0301 |
Module Type | Analog Output Module |
Output Type | 4-20 mA, 0-10 V DC |
Input | Digital/Control Signal (from Controller) |
Power Supply | 24 V DC ± 10% |
Operating Temperature | -40°C to 70°C |
Humidity Range | 5% to 95%, non-condensing |
Communication Protocol | Modbus RTU or custom (depending on configuration) |
Dimensions | 140 x 90 x 35 mm |
Weight | 0.227 kg |
Mounting | DIN Rail Mount |
Housing Material | Flame Retardant ABS |
Isolation | Galvanic Isolation |
Certifications | CE, UL, CSA |
Operating Voltage | 24V ± 10% |
